Where Will I Travel To?

The starting point of your journey into the Amazon is Leticia, Colombia. This lies on the Amazon River uniting the borders of Colombia, Peru and Brazil. This area is called 'Tres Fronteras,’ and is ´The Golden Triangle´ of the Amazon and from here your route will take you to various locations where you will be immersed in the local culture and communities.

 87 kilometres from Leticia is Puerto Nariño, home of the indigenous rainforest Ticuna tribe which lies on the shore of the Amazon River. You'll rest for the night in a hammock in Sacambu.This journey into Leticia and the rest of the Amazon is so far removed from civilization as we know it, taking you to hidden away corners of the world that are home to the vibrant cultures such as the Huitotos and Yucunas. Not to mention the hundreds of species of reptiles and mammals. Is it Difficult? What Kinds of Things Will I Do There?

It's not easy. When we tell you it's a challenge, we mean it. But we are sure it's nothing you can't handle. The activities you'll participate in during your Amazon Jungle Adventure are varied and unique to the Colombian Amazon. One day, you'll be bird watching, spotting pink dolphins, or fishing for piranhas. The next day, competing in the indigenous Olympics, doing archery, canoeing, swimming, and blow pipe competitions with your fellow adventurers. You'll go on night walks for some nocturnal cayman spotting, or whatever other animals like the cooler night temperatures. Being in the jungle is not always comfortable. It is hot, humid, and there are a few pesky things like mosquitoes. However, sitting at home on the couch being cushy and comfy is not the stuff from which amazing stories are made.
